Transaction b38536b175f96e9bfe370acfa05454e2977036cb5fde49806704b134dcbd841d
1 Input
2 Outputs
- b38536b175f96e9bfe370acfa05454e2977036cb5fde49806704b134dcbd841d:0
- b38536b175f96e9bfe370acfa05454e2977036cb5fde49806704b134dcbd841d:1
value 56103153
address 12UaoH1hQN9GLM25fPpDsYtEdeDFMNjNSc
value 43190000
address 145tHaUDe8EAtA1y1avr7uPiP8mwWbgw2a